Quinoa with Sun Dried Tomatoes and Feta

Katerina | Diethood
Sun dried tomatoes and salty feta add so much flavor to this quinoa recipe!
No ratings yet
Servings : 4 servings
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es

Ingredients
  

For the Quinoa
  • 1 1/2 cups quinoa
  • 3 cups water
  • 8 to 10 sun dried tomatoes , chopped
  • 1/3 c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 2 tablespoons freeze-dried basil (if you have fresh basil, use 1 tablespoon chopped basil)
For the Dressing
  • 4 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
  • salt and pepper

Instructions
 

  • In a medium sized saucepan combine the water and quinoa; bring to a vigorous boil.
  • Reduce the heat, cover and let simmer until quinoa is tender, about 15 minutes.
  • Remove from heat and fluff up with a fork.
  • Transfer the quinoa to a bowl and mix in the sun dried tomatoes, feta, and basil.
  • Make the dressing by placing all ingredients in a small bowl; whisk together until thoroughly combined.
  • Pour the dressing over the quinoa, toss, and serve.

Notes

Use the dry sun-dried tomatoes and not the ones that come in a jar with oil.
